Web development has become an essential part of the modern digital landscape, with businesses, organizations, and individuals relying heavily on websites to engage with their audiences. As the internet continues to evolve, so too does web development, pushing the boundaries of what is possible and offering new opportunities for innovation. From the simplest blogs to complex, data-driven platforms, web development is at the core of how we interact online.
At its core, web development involves the creation and maintenance of websites. It includes everything from designing the layout, structure, and user interface to writing code that makes the website functional and interactive. Over time, web development has grown to include various specializations such as front-end, back-end, and full-stack development. Front-end development focuses on what users see and https://newlivecasinosonline.co.uk interact with directly, such as the layout, design, and animations. Back-end development deals with the server-side operations, such as databases and application logic, ensuring that everything works behind the scenes. Full-stack developers have expertise in both areas, allowing them to create comprehensive web applications.
With the rapid advancements in technology, web development has seen a significant shift in recent years. Responsive web design, for example, has become a necessity in today’s mobile-first world. Websites must now be designed to adapt to different screen sizes, providing a seamless user experience across desktops, tablets, and smartphones. Frameworks like Bootstrap and Foundation have made it easier for developers to create responsive websites, ensuring that users can access content no matter the device they use.
Another important trend in web development is the rise of JavaScript frameworks and libraries. Tools like React, Angular, and Vue.js have revolutionized front-end development, allowing developers to create dynamic, interactive user interfaces more efficiently. These frameworks help streamline the development process and offer reusable components, reducing the amount of code that needs to be written.
The growth of cloud computing and web hosting services has also had a profound impact on web development. Cloud platforms like AWS and Microsoft Azure provide developers with scalable infrastructure, enabling them to build powerful web applications without the need for complex hardware setups. With cloud computing, businesses can deploy and manage websites with ease, while also ensuring that they can handle a growing number of users.
Despite these advancements, web development faces its share of challenges. Ensuring website security is a top priority, as cyber threats continue to evolve. Developers must use best practices to protect user data and prevent attacks such as cross-site scripting and SQL injection. Additionally, with the increasing reliance on web applications, performance optimization remains a critical focus, as slow-loading websites can negatively impact user experience and search engine rankings.
As web development continues to evolve, the future looks promising. With the rise of artificial intelligence, machine learning, and immersive technologies like virtual and augmented reality, web developers will continue to push the boundaries of what’s possible. The role of a web developer will remain essential as businesses strive to stay competitive in a digital-first world, offering endless opportunities for innovation and creativity.